Everything in college sophomore Mila Kozak's life is picture perfect. She has an amazing boyfriend, Michael. Her relationship with her sister, Anya, is worthy of envy. Even her sport of choice—show jumping—is Instagram-worthy. All she's missing is Prince Charming. In horse-form, that is. But as Mila searches for the ideal horse, the rest of her flawless world begins to unravel. And she's left wondering if it was all that perfect to begin with. Set in the world of competitive show jumping, this novella peels back the filter of a picture-perfect life.
Tiffany was riding horses before she could walk. She's a five-time IAHA national champion and competed regularly at the Winter Equestrian Festival with her gentle giant, Obi-Wan. She received her Masters of Fine Arts in Creative Writing from the University of Tampa. This is her debut novel - an outpouring of her love for horses, and her love for love. She lives in Tampa with her middle-school sweetheart and her two wild and crazy sons.
